Navigation

    Logo
    • Register
    • Login
    • Search
    • Recent
    • Tags
    • Unread
    • Categories
    • Unreplied
    • Popular
    • GitHub
    • Docu
    • Hilfe
    1. Home
    2. Deutsch
    3. Skripten / Logik
    4. Awattar - die billigsten Strom-Stunden nutzen

    NEWS

    • ioBroker@Smart Living Forum Solingen, 14.06. - Agenda added

    • ioBroker goes Matter ... Matter Adapter in Stable

    • Monatsrückblick - April 2025

    Awattar - die billigsten Strom-Stunden nutzen

    This topic has been deleted. Only users with topic management privileges can see it.
    • D
      Doom.86 @paul53 last edited by Doom.86

      @paul53 ich sage erstmal vielen lieben Dank für deine Mühe. Ich schaue es mir an, sobald ich zuhause bin und werde dann Rückmeldung geben.

      Edit: hab ich es an den Bildern übersehen, wo trage ich die id von Warmwasser bzw FBH ein? Dort reicht es, wenn preis günstig erhöhe aktuellen Wert zb. Um 4 nach Ablauf der Zeit veringere diesen Wert wieder um 4.

      paul53 1 Reply Last reply Reply Quote 0
      • paul53
        paul53 @Doom.86 last edited by

        @doom-86 sagte: wo trage ich die id von Warmwasser bzw FBH ein?

        Dort, wo die Blöcke "steuere" sitzen: FBH bei end3h, schedule3 und schedule4.

        D 1 Reply Last reply Reply Quote 0
        • D
          Doom.86 @paul53 last edited by Doom.86

          @paul53 ach, gleich in der dritten zeile von dem ersten screenshot?

          Und dahinter dann den wert mit erhöhe um 4?

          Ich probier es nachher zu hause aus. Übers handy ließ er mich nicht mal den Code kopieren.

          paul53 1 Reply Last reply Reply Quote 0
          • paul53
            paul53 @Doom.86 last edited by paul53

            @doom-86 sagte: gleich in der dritten zeile von dem ersten screenshot?
            Und dahinter dann den wert mit erhöhe um 4?

            Stattdessen: Verringere den Wert um 4.
            Und unten:

            Bild_2023-01-10_203429592.png

            D 1 Reply Last reply Reply Quote 0
            • D
              Doom.86 @paul53 last edited by Doom.86

              @paul53 So schaut es jetzt bei mir aus.
              Screenshot 2023-01-10 232510.jpg
              Screenshot 2023-01-10 232542.jpg

              ich hoffe das passt so?

              Einzige was mir unter Protokolle ausgewurfen wurde ist:
              2023-01-10 23:10:19.125 warn State "javascript.1.scriptEnabled.Heizung_Nacht_Tibber" has no existing object, this might lead to an error in future versions

              naja, ich hab jetzt die Zwei Werte der Heizung in die History aufgenommen. so sollte ich die Tage sehen, ob es funktioniert.

              Edit: Die Meldung aus dem Protokoll kam jetzt nur einmal, beim ersten Start des Skripts. Als ich es gestoppt habe und nochmals gestartet, kam diese Meldung nicht mehr.

              paul53 1 Reply Last reply Reply Quote 0
              • paul53
                paul53 @Doom.86 last edited by paul53

                @doom-86 sagte: ich hoffe das passt so?

                Das muss oben (Ausschalten um 17:59 Uhr) genauso gehandhabt werden wie unten

                Bild_2023-01-10_234831499.png

                Es genügt, den WW-Sollwert um 4 K zu verringern?

                D 1 Reply Last reply Reply Quote 0
                • D
                  Doom.86 @paul53 last edited by Doom.86

                  @paul53 sagte in Awattar - die billigsten Strom-Stunden nutzen:

                  @doom-86 sagte: ich hoffe das passt so?

                  Das muss oben (Ausschalten um 17:59 Uhr) genauso gehandhabt werden wie unten

                  Bild_2023-01-10_234831499.png

                  Es genügt, den WW-Sollwert um 4 K zu verringern?

                  Ich möchte ja ein überheizen. somit muss doch die WW Temp und die Raumtemperatur erhöht werden? oder habe ich jetzt einen Denkfehler?

                  Wenn ich aktuell zB. 44°C als WW-Temperatur eingestellt habe, möchte dann in der Nacht wenn der Strom günstig ist, die WW-Temperatur auf 48°C erhöhen, dann muss ich doch +4 und nach der 1 Stunde des Zeitplans wieder -4, damit ich wieder auf meine Anfangs 44°C komme?

                  EDIT: Ich habe eben gesehen, dass die Preise in dem Tibber Adapter von Morgen nicht gelöscht werden. Jetzt stehen bei heute und morgen die Identischen Preise drinnen.

                  paul53 1 Reply Last reply Reply Quote 0
                  • paul53
                    paul53 @Doom.86 last edited by

                    @doom-86 sagte: Jetzt stehen bei heute und morgen die Identischen Preise drinnen.

                    Hauptsache, die Preise stimmen um 17:59 Uhr.

                    @doom-86 sagte in Awattar - die billigsten Strom-Stunden nutzen:

                    die WW-Temperatur auf 48°C erhöhen, dann muss ich doch +4 und nach der 1 Stunde des Zeitplans wieder -4, damit ich wieder auf meine Anfangs 44°C komme?

                    Wenn im Laufe des Tages die WW-Temperatur von 48°C auf 44°C sinkt - was nicht viel ist, schaltet der interne Regler die Heizung unabhängig vom Strompreis ein.

                    D 2 Replies Last reply Reply Quote 0
                    • D
                      Doom.86 @paul53 last edited by

                      @paul53

                      @doom-86 sagte in Awattar - die billigsten Strom-Stunden nutzen:

                      die WW-Temperatur auf 48°C erhöhen, dann muss ich doch +4 und nach der 1 Stunde des Zeitplans wieder -4, damit ich wieder auf meine Anfangs 44°C komme?

                      Wenn im Laufe des Tages die WW-Temperatur von 48°C auf 44°C sinkt - was nicht viel ist, schaltet der interne Regler die Heizung unabhängig vom Strompreis ein.

                      Richtig aktuell hab ich die Anlage im tagbetrieb und über einen Zeitplan gesteuert. Tagsüber ww-soll 40°C in der Nacht WW-Soll 48°C. Durch die hysterese heizt die wärmepumpe auf ca. 50 - 51°C auf. Tagsüber fällt die Temperatur je nach Verbrauch langsam oder schneller ab. Wenn diese am Tag auf 38°C abfällt, läuft die wärmepumpe an und heizt mit hysterese auf ca 42°C auf.

                      Nächste bzw spätestens übernächste woche wird mein wärmepumpen Zähler ausgebaut, dann läuft diese auch über tibber.
                      Daher auch die Steuerung.

                      1 Reply Last reply Reply Quote 0
                      • D
                        Doom.86 @paul53 last edited by

                        @paul53 jetzt wurde das ganze eben ausgeführt. Nun die Frage, liegen die Fehlermeldungen daran. Dass tibber aktuell Probleme hat? Bekomme keine live Daten mehr in iobroker. Die heutigen und morgigen preise wurden allerdings noch richtig gesetzt.

                        Screenshot_20230111_180331_Chrome.jpg

                        paul53 1 Reply Last reply Reply Quote 0
                        • paul53
                          paul53 @Doom.86 last edited by paul53

                          @doom-86
                          Nicht lesbar: Bitte in Code tags posten!

                          Den String der Variablen tibber hast Du für Deinen Account angepasst?

                          D 1 Reply Last reply Reply Quote 0
                          • D
                            Doom.86 @paul53 last edited by Doom.86

                            @paul53 geht es so?

                            2023-01-11 17:59:00.130 - warn: javascript.0 (11927) getState "tibberconnect.1.Homes.9aefe294-bfba-4283-a708-c12c926bXXXXPricesTomorrow.16.total" not found (3)
                            2023-01-11 17:59:00.131 - warn: javascript.0 (11927) at Object. (script.js.Heizung_Nacht_Tibber:19:17)
                            2023-01-11 17:59:00.131 - warn: javascript.0 (11927) at Job.job (/opt/iobroker/node_modules/iobroker.javascript/lib/sandbox.js:1595:34)
                            2023-01-11 17:59:00.131 - warn: javascript.0 (11927) at Job.invoke (/opt/iobroker/node_modules/node-schedule/lib/Job.js:171:15)
                            2023-01-11 17:59:00.131 - warn: javascript.0 (11927) at /opt/iobroker/node_modules/node-schedule/lib/Invocation.js:268:28
                            2023-01-11 17:59:00.131 - warn: javascript.0 (11927) at Timeout._onTimeout (/opt/iobroker/node_modules/node-schedule/lib/Invocation.js:228:7)
                            2023-01-11 17:59:00.131 - warn: javascript.0 (11927) at listOnTimeout (node:internal/timers:559:17)
                            2023-01-11 17:59:00.131 - warn: javascript.0 (11927) at processTimers (node:internal/timers:502:7)
                            2023-01-11 17:59:00.132 - warn: javascript.0 (11927) getState "tibberconnect.1.Homes.9aefe294-bfba-4283-a708-c12c926bXXXXPricesTomorrow.17.total" not found (3)
                            2023-01-11 17:59:00.136 - warn: javascript.0 (11927) at Object. (script.js.Heizung_Nacht_Tibber:19:17)
                            2023-01-11 17:59:00.136 - warn: javascript.0 (11927) at Job.job (/opt/iobroker/node_modules/iobroker.javascript/lib/sandbox.js:1595:34)
                            2023-01-11 17:59:00.136 - warn: javascript.0 (11927) at Job.invoke (/opt/iobroker/node_modules/node-schedule/lib/Job.js:171:15)
                            2023-01-11 17:59:00.136 - warn: javascript.0 (11927) at /opt/iobroker/node_modules/node-schedule/lib/Invocation.js:268:28
                            2023-01-11 17:59:00.136 - warn: javascript.0 (11927) at Timeout._onTimeout (/opt/iobroker/node_modules/node-schedule/lib/Invocation.js:228:7)
                            2023-01-11 17:59:00.137 - warn: javascript.0 (11927) at listOnTimeout (node:internal/timers:559:17)
                            2023-01-11 17:59:00.137 - warn: javascript.0 (11927) at processTimers (node:internal/timers:502:7)
                            2023-01-11 17:59:00.143 - error: javascript.0 (11927) script.js.Heizung_Nacht_Tibber: TypeError: Cannot read properties of undefined (reading 'toString')
                            2023-01-11 17:59:00.144 - error: javascript.0 (11927) at Object. (script.js.Heizung_Nacht_Tibber:54:62)
                            2023-01-11 17:59:00.144 - error: javascript.0 (11927) at Job.job (/opt/iobroker/node_modules/iobroker.javascript/lib/sandbox.js:1595:34)
                            2023-01-11 17:59:00.144 - error: javascript.0 (11927) at Job.invoke (/opt/iobroker/node_modules/node-schedule/lib/Job.js:171:15)
                            2023-01-11 17:59:00.145 - error: javascript.0 (11927) at /opt/iobroker/node_modules/node-schedule/lib/Invocation.js:268:28
                            2023-01-11 17:59:00.145 - error: javascript.0 (11927) at Timeout._onTimeout (/opt/iobroker/node_modules/node-schedule/lib/Invocation.js:228:7)
                            2023-01-11 17:59:00.145 - error: javascript.0 (11927) at listOnTimeout (node:internal/timers:559:17)
                            2023-01-11 17:59:00.145 - error: javascript.0 (11927) at processTimers (node:internal/timers:502:7)
                            

                            MOD-EDIT: Code in code-tags gesetzt!

                            Das zieht sich so weiter. Und tibber hat wie gesagt scheinbar Probleme heute.

                            paul53 1 Reply Last reply Reply Quote 0
                            • paul53
                              paul53 @Doom.86 last edited by paul53

                              @doom-86 sagte:

                              getState "tibberconnect.1.Homes.9aefe294-bfba-4283-a708-c12c926b4a69PricesTomorrow.16.total" not found
                              

                              Am Ende des Strings der Variablen tibber fehlt ein Punkt! Richtig:

                              tibberconnect.1.Homes.9aefe294-bfba-4283-a708-c12c926b4a69.PricesTomorrow.16.total
                              
                              D 2 Replies Last reply Reply Quote 0
                              • D
                                Doom.86 @paul53 last edited by Doom.86

                                @paul53 ah. Alles klar. Vielen Dank. Dann morgen auf einen neuen Versuch. Vorausgesetzt tibber bringt ihr Zeug auch wieder auf die Reihe. Bekomme aktuell keine Daten mehr. Auf ihrer Homepage steht etwas mit Problemen.

                                1 Reply Last reply Reply Quote 0
                                • D
                                  Doom.86 @paul53 last edited by

                                  @paul53 Hallo Paul. Es funktioniert. alles so weit. Vielen Dank für deine mühe.
                                  Eine kleine Frage habe ich noch, lassen sich die Zeiten evtl in einem Datenpunkt auswerten, um diese für andere Dinge zu nutzen oder zur kontrolle, welche Uhrzeiten er berechnet hat?

                                  paul53 1 Reply Last reply Reply Quote 0
                                  • paul53
                                    paul53 @Doom.86 last edited by paul53

                                    @doom-86 sagte: lassen sich die Zeiten evtl in einem Datenpunkt auswerten

                                    Welche Zeiten? start1h, start3h? Die lassen sich nach der Ermittlung in Datenpunkte schreiben ("aktualisiere").

                                    D 1 Reply Last reply Reply Quote 0
                                    • D
                                      Doom.86 @paul53 last edited by

                                      @paul53 genau die meinte ich. Wie setze ich die dann am besten ein?

                                      paul53 1 Reply Last reply Reply Quote 0
                                      • paul53
                                        paul53 @Doom.86 last edited by

                                        @doom-86 sagte: Wie setze ich die dann am besten ein?

                                        Z.B. ganz unten im Trigger (vor oder nach den Zeitplänen).

                                        D 1 Reply Last reply Reply Quote 0
                                        • D
                                          Doom.86 @paul53 last edited by

                                          @paul53 perfekt. Vielen lieben Dank dafür nochmals.
                                          Jetzt verstehe ich wenigsten schon ein wenig mehr von dem ganzen.

                                          1 Reply Last reply Reply Quote 0
                                          • P
                                            peter969 @paul53 last edited by

                                            @paul53 Hi, ich habe mir aus Post 36 das Skript geholt und meine Funksteckdosen bei "steuere" eingefügt. Leider werden diese nicht geschaltet. Muss ich noch was ändern/machen? Ich sehe da nicht so wirklich durch.

                                            1 Reply Last reply Reply Quote 0
                                            • First post
                                              Last post

                                            Support us

                                            ioBroker
                                            Community Adapters
                                            Donate

                                            815
                                            Online

                                            31.7k
                                            Users

                                            79.8k
                                            Topics

                                            1.3m
                                            Posts

                                            10
                                            82
                                            8012
                                            Loading More Posts
                                            • Oldest to Newest
                                            • Newest to Oldest
                                            • Most Votes
                                            Reply
                                            • Reply as topic
                                            Log in to reply
                                            Community
                                            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en
                                            The ioBroker Community 2014-2023
                                            logo